[Ulcerated plantar lichen planus. Successful treatment with cyclosporine]
Abstract
Plantar ulcerations of lichen planus are unusual manifestations that constrain the patient's quality of life and are often refractory to treatment. We report on a 71-year-old man in whom a prompt and complete healing of plantar ulcerative lichen planus was achieved by treatment with oral cyclosporine.
